Timing Your Adventure in Davao de Oro
Choosing the right time to visit Davao de Oro can significantly enhance your experience. The ideal months for travel are typically from November to May, when the weather is dry and pleasant. This is the perfect season for outdoor activities, allowing you to fully enjoy the natural wonders of the province without the hindrance of rain. During these months, you can explore the stunning beaches, hike the scenic trails, and partake in various local events.
In addition to favorable weather, planning your visit around local festivals can provide an even richer experience. The *Araw ng Davao* festival, celebrated in March, showcases the vibrant culture of the region through colorful parades, traditional dances, and local cuisine. Participating in such events allows travelers to engage with the community and gain insight into the local customs and traditions. Keep an eye on the local calendar to catch these lively celebrations during your stay.
While the dry season is popular, the rainy months from June to October also have their charm. The landscape becomes lush and vibrant, and the waterfalls are at their most spectacular. If you prefer a quieter experience with fewer tourists, visiting during the off-peak months can be a great option. Just be sure to pack an umbrella and be prepared for the occasional downpour!

Indulge in Davao de Oro's Culinary Delights
Food lovers will find Davao de Oro to be a culinary haven, offering a delightful mix of traditional Filipino dishes and local specialties. The province is renowned for its fresh seafood, particularly in coastal areas where you can enjoy the catch of the day. Don’t miss the chance to savor *kinilaw*, a local dish made from raw fish marinated in vinegar and spices, which is a must-try for any visitor. Many restaurants along the coast serve this dish alongside other local favorites like *adobo* and *sinigang*, providing a true taste of the region.
Local markets are also a fantastic way to experience Davao de Oro's culinary offerings. The bustling atmosphere allows you to sample various street foods, from grilled skewers to sweet treats like *bibingka*, a rice cake often enjoyed during festivals. Engaging with local vendors not only supports the community but also offers a chance to learn about the ingredients and cooking methods unique to the area.
For a more upscale dining experience, several hotels and resorts in Davao de Oro feature restaurants that highlight the region's flavors while providing a stunning ambiance. Many establishments focus on farm-to-table dining, ensuring that the ingredients are fresh and locally sourced. Whether you’re enjoying a casual meal or a fine dining experience, the culinary delights of Davao de Oro are sure to satisfy your palate.
